Job Title: Estimator
Job Summary: The overall goal of the Estimator is to provide a thorough, accurate, and competitive proposal that will result in the award of a profitable project.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ities will include:
- Provide thorough, accurate and competitive cost estimates through all phases of design, from concept to construction and permit documents.
- Determine proposal specifications and the scope of work by reviewing drawings, attending and/or managing bid and preconstruction meetings, etc.
- Analyze and document cost analysis from historical projects, purchase orders, contracts, and cost reports for future use in incorporating into estimates.
- Provide design assistance and cost data regarding project feasibility to the client, design professionals, and project team.
- Prepare bid packages and provide leadership and coordination on bid solicitation and RFP's.
- Develop scopes of work for sub-trades prior to and during bid solicitation.
- Perform takeoffs of multiple trades to minimize the Company's cost risks.
- Analyze proposals from subcontractors for cost, scope and completeness to determine award of work.
- Identify and qualify new subcontractors to ensure an adequate number of qualified and financially sound subcontractors are available and to expand bid solicitation coverage.
- Prepare preliminary project schedules during the preconstruction phase and assist the Superintendent with the contracted schedule prior to construction.
- Assist with pricing and negotiating owner and subcontractor change orders.
- Maintain detailed records of working documents as a back-up for estimates figures, including assumptions made for conceptual designs.
- Other duties as assigned.
